Don't underestimate all three parts of this card:
1. Turning a creature red can make them susceptible to Doom Blade even if they were black, as well as play into Protection from Red and Radiance (the old Boros mechanic) tricks. In-block, Balefire Liege and other "color matters" cards could benefit from this - with a Liege out, it's a good 3 damage to the dome for just .
2. Haste is best when it's cheap or already on a creature, and at and as a common it's an inexpensive way to rush an opponent before they're ready - particularly with oversized creatures like Cosmic Larva. Swinging for 7 with trample on turn 3-4 is nothing to scoff at.
3. Any time you can replace a card in your hand for you should take note - red is traditionally not an amazing card-drawing color and can run out of ideas fast. With a creature out, at worst this is just : draw a card at instant speed. Heck, you can even play it at the end of your opponent's turn on their creature if you need the card that badly.

I don't understand why this card is so poorly rated. Hand: Kiln Fiend, Crimson Wisps, Mountain, Lotus Petal, Simian Spirit Guide, Elvish Spirit Guide, Gitaxian Probe. Play mountain, exile elvish guide for Kiln Fiend. Play lotus petal, sac for red, crimson wisps. Draw an Assault Strobe. Play Assault Strobe by exiling simian guide. Play G Probe (or any other free spell). Swing for game. Turn 1 win, with all commons, thanks to this bad boy.
